Cropmate obtains approval for Bursa listing

KUALA LUMPUR: Cropmate Bhd has received the approval to list on the ACE Market of Bursa Malaysia.

The company's listing will involve a public issue of 210 million new ordinary shares and an offer for sale of 50 million shares.

Cropmate managing director Lee Chin Yok said as the first-ever pure-play fertiliser company to be listed on Bursa, the listing represents a landmark achievement for the company.

"It not only elevates our profile but also positions us strategically within the market, enabling us to broaden our reach and impact across the Malaysian agricultural sector.

"The funds raised will be instrumental in supporting our strategic initiatives, particularly the upgrade of automated weighing process, setting up research and development and test laboratory, purchase equipment and vehicles and the acquisition of the factories," he said.

Among the company's product offerings include conventional fertilisers comprising compacted and blended fertilisers, as well as specialty fertilisers.

The latter comprises semi-organic, organic, and liquid fertilisers to meet the nutrient requirements of the plant covering nursery, flowering and maturity stages.

Cropmate is also involved in the trading of straight fertilisers and related products.

The company recorded a revenue of RM151.5 million for the year ended 2023, supported by the formulation and blending segment which accounted for RM112.1 million.
